Programming Reference

The Ultra3000 Drive with DeviceNet implements a vendor specific
device profile - Rockwell Automation Miscellaneous (Device Type:
73hex).

The configuration data and behaviors implemented in the Ultra3000
Drive with DeviceNet are defined using object modeling. The
Ultra3000 Drive with DeviceNet is modeled as a collection of objects.
An Object is a collection of related attributes and services. An attribute
is an externally visible characteristic or feature of an object, while a
service is a procedure an object can perform.

The following general definitions also may be useful in understanding
DeviceNet object modeling:

• Object - A representation of a particular type of data component

within the DeviceNet node.

• Instance - A specific occurrence of an Object.
• Attribute - A description of a characteristic or feature of an Object.

Attributes provide status information or govern the operation of an
Object.

• Service - A function performed by an Object.

This manual documents the DeviceNet object models implemented in
DeviceNet firmware versions 2.xx for the Ultra3000 drives.
